+class ControlLoop(object):
+  def __init__(self, name):
+    """Constructs a control loop object.
+
+    Args:
+      name: string, The name of the loop to use when writing the C++ files.
+    """
+    self._name = name
+
+  def ContinuousToDiscrete(self, A_continuous, B_continuous, dt):
+    """Calculates the discrete time values for A and B.
+
+      Args:
+        A_continuous: numpy.matrix, The continuous time A matrix
+        B_continuous: numpy.matrix, The continuous time B matrix
+        dt: float, The time step of the control loop
+
+      Returns:
+        (A, B), numpy.matrix, the control matricies.
+    """
+    return controls.c2d(A_continuous, B_continuous, dt)
+
+  def InitializeState(self):
+    """Sets X, Y, and X_hat to zero defaults."""
+    self.X = numpy.zeros((self.A.shape[0], 1))
+    self.Y = self.C * self.X
+    self.X_hat = numpy.zeros((self.A.shape[0], 1))
+
+  def PlaceControllerPoles(self, poles):
+    """Places the controller poles.
+
+    Args:
+      poles: array, An array of poles.  Must be complex conjegates if they have
+        any imaginary portions.
+    """
+    self.K = controls.dplace(self.A, self.B, poles)
+
+  def PlaceObserverPoles(self, poles):
+    """Places the observer poles.
+
+    Args:
+      poles: array, An array of poles.  Must be complex conjegates if they have
+        any imaginary portions.
+    """
+    self.L = controls.dplace(self.A.T, self.C.T, poles).T
+
+  def Update(self, U):
+    """Simulates one time step with the provided U."""
+    U = numpy.clip(U, self.U_min, self.U_max)
+    self.X = self.A * self.X + self.B * U
+    self.Y = self.C * self.X + self.D * U
+
+  def UpdateObserver(self, U):
+    """Updates the observer given the provided U."""
+    self.X_hat = (self.A * self.X_hat + self.B * U +
+                  self.L * (self.Y - self.C * self.X_hat - self.D * U))
